"Synopsis: Low: tzdata update Issue date: 2009-09-30 This updated package addresses the following change to Daylight Saving Time (DST) observations: * Pakistan was previously expected to switch back to standard time at 00:00 (midnight), between October 31st and November 1st 2009. Pakistan is now set to leave Daylight Savings Time (DST) at midnight between September 30th and October 1st 2009. This updated tzdata package reflects this change.
